Survey: President Trump Remains Popular Among Hoosiers

The president's approval rating has increased since 2017.

(Muncie, Ind.) - A recent survey shows that President Trump remain popular in the State of Indiana.

The annual Old National Bank/Ball State University 2019 Hoosier Survey showed that 52 percent of Hoosiers approve of Trump’s job performance. 40 percent disapproved.

With impeachment hearings scheduled for Wednesday, it doesn't appear Hoosiers want to see President Trump removed from office. 

His approval numbers are highly reflected party affiliation with an 86 percent approval rating among Republicans.

Either way, Trump’s approval rating has improved since 2017, when only 41 percent of Hoosiers approved of his performance. 

The survey also asked Hoosiers about Democratic presidential candidates. Joe Biden was the most recognizable name among the candidates, followed by Bernie Sanders and Elizabeth Warren. 

At the state level, approximately 50 percent approved of Governor Eric Holcomb’s performance. Only 17 percent disapproved of the Indiana Governor.
